Every enlisted recruit starts out as an E1, and can expect an annual salary of around $20,170.80. BMT is 10 weeks, so the average E1 payment for basic training is around $3,800 plus meals and housing.

Nov 16, 2023 · Members receive retirement pay that is based on 50% of the average of the highest 36 months of basic pay after 20 years of service. Another 2.5% is given for each additional year. Let's talk about Military Pay (for all ...How to determine your pay base: If you entered the military before September 8, 1980, your pay base is equal to the salary you received in your entire final month of service ; If you entered the military on or after September 8, 1980, your pay base equals your average monthly salary for the last three years of your military career.

As part of the military pay and benefits package, military service members earn 30 days of paid leave per year. You start at zero and for every month of military service, 2.5 days of leave get added to your leave account.
